Before we get to today's quote, here's a little background on the author. William James was an American philosopher and psychologist who lived from 1842 to 1910. Often called the father of American psychology, he helped establish psychology as a scientific discipline and was a leading voice in the philosophical movement known as pragmatism. His work explored the connections between thought, emotion, habit, and human flourishing, and it continues to influence psychology and self-development today.
Today's quote comes from William James:
”Action may not always bring happiness, but there is no happiness without action.”
Many of us wait for the perfect moment before taking the first step.
We tell ourselves we'll be happier once we get the promotion, lose the weight, write the book, or start the business.
But William James suggests something different.
Happiness isn't simply something we find.
It's something we create through action.
Taking a walk can lift your mood.
Calling an old friend can strengthen a relationship.
Learning a new skill can build confidence.
Helping someone else can bring a deep sense of purpose.
Will every action lead to happiness?
Of course not.
Sometimes we'll fail.
Sometimes things won't go as planned.
But doing nothing almost guarantees that nothing will change.
Progress begins the moment we move.
So here's the question: What's one small action you could take today that your future self will thank you for?
Remember, you don't have to feel perfectly ready before you begin. Often, the act of taking that first step creates the momentum, confidence, and joy you've been waiting for.
